Automatic Flight EICAS Messages
The following EICAS messages can be displayed.
Message Level Aural Condition
AUTOPILOT Caution Beeper One or more of these occur:
• The autopilot is in a degraded mode
other than the selected mode
• The engaged roll mode is failed
• The engaged pitch mode is failed
• The autopilot is in flight envelope
protection
AUTOPILOT
DISC
Warning Siren All autopilots are disconnected.
AUTOTHROTTL
E DISC
Caution Beeper Both autothrottles are disconnected.
AUTOTHROTTL
E L, R
Advisory The affected autothrottle is inoperative.
A/P BACKDRIVE
COLUMN
Caution Beeper The autopilot can no longer backdrive the
control column to match the position of the
elevator.
A/P BACKDRIVE
PEDAL
Caution Beeper The autopilot can no longer backdrive the
rudder pedals to match the position of the
rudder during autoland approaches.
A/P BACKDRIVE
WHEEL
Caution Beeper The autopilot can no longer backdrive the
control wheel to match the position of the
ailerons.
NO AUTOLAND Caution
Advisory
Beeper The autoland system is not available.
Message is a caution if fault occurs after
LAND 3 or LAND 2 is annunciated, or
approach has been selected but does not
engage by 600 AGL. Message is an
advisory if fault occurs before LAND 3 or
LAND 2 is annunciated.
NO AUTOLAND
GLS
Advisory The autoland system is not available for a
GLS approach.
NO AUTOLAND
ILS
Advisory The autoland system is not available for an
ILS approach.
